Carpet Bowling

 

Program Description

 

A structured group to enhance or maintain physical abilities that provides enjoyment and socialization in a positive setting.  Residents will have the opportunity to participate in a familiar activity or to discover a new leisure interest.

 

Goal of the program is to:

 

  • Provide an opportunity to maintain and/or increase eye-hand coordination.
  • Provide an opportunity for physical activity.
  • Introduce a new leisure skill to residents.
  • Provide opportunity for competition.
  • Provide opportunity for socialization.
  • Provide opportunity for general stimulation.

 

 

Volunteer Job Description

 

 Help with set up –

 

  • Pick up bowling equipment from recreation’s storage room and take to the unit (only if the recreation staff ask to do so).
  • With the direction of the recreation staff, help to set up the bowling.

 

Help to gather residents

 

  • For the first few volunteer shifts, volunteer will follow the recreation staff to the residents’ rooms while the staff ask the residents out to bowling; then the volunteer can porter the residents to the bowling area while the staff continue to invite the other residents. 
  • The volunteer should ask the residents where they would like to sit.  
  • Go back to get other residents that have agreed to come.
  • As the volunteer become familiar with the residents, the volunteer can go and invite the residents to the bowling independently – saving the staff time.

 

Assist with the playing of the game

 

  • The volunteer may help set up the bowling pins and return the balls to the cart once they are thrown. 

 

Encourage and cheer for the residents!!  It makes the game much more exciting!
